From bcdc0ba95c8dbf5edbde7845bb161b8dddbc5796 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E6=9D=8E=E5=85=89=E6=98=A5?= Date: Thu, 1 Sep 2022 17:20:42 +0800 Subject: [PATCH] - update --- const.go | 2 +- go.mod | 4 ++-- go.sum | 8 ++++---- wxa.get_qrcode.go | 2 +- 4 files changed, 8 insertions(+), 8 deletions(-) diff --git a/const.go b/const.go index 16e3e32..234c104 100644 --- a/const.go +++ b/const.go @@ -3,5 +3,5 @@ package wechatopen const ( apiUrl = "https://api.weixin.qq.com" logTable = "wechatopen" - Version = "1.0.22" + Version = "1.0.23" ) diff --git a/go.mod b/go.mod index f883d39..36d0701 100644 --- a/go.mod +++ b/go.mod @@ -5,8 +5,8 @@ go 1.19 require ( github.com/mitchellh/mapstructure v1.5.0 go.dtapp.net/dorm v1.0.30 - go.dtapp.net/golog v1.0.50 - go.dtapp.net/gorequest v1.0.27 + go.dtapp.net/golog v1.0.51 + go.dtapp.net/gorequest v1.0.28 ) require ( diff --git a/go.sum b/go.sum index d54675c..c400698 100644 --- a/go.sum +++ b/go.sum @@ -521,12 +521,12 @@ go.dtapp.net/dorm v1.0.30 h1:B2gwSe1ov4S+LPUv1ijFm4XE2KEeNn85eCP4WLilsCU= go.dtapp.net/dorm v1.0.30/go.mod h1:7ysGN47mW3u0EDAzXI3oUYZZHA3uasf2spugHeANPW8= go.dtapp.net/goip v1.0.28 h1:wZt+wbzNhOLRUJnepG4c8HhUr4V9jNXOF6wJ1h7jUvU= go.dtapp.net/goip v1.0.28/go.mod h1:ZqPPUvpOSzdtB/dEZFiaD0CBRZmvIzjDmm3XkpMC9Bo= -go.dtapp.net/golog v1.0.50 h1:J+ji1rso4GSN5gR2/ugyQNa8Akp9kY0zx+CkaWKimVk= -go.dtapp.net/golog v1.0.50/go.mod h1:QHP4MZoUZUtw1/pgBu7V5RIw766g2KrI44W0q6sj/40= +go.dtapp.net/golog v1.0.51 h1:FIXZdwN+Vn4mj7QafY4w/BKQiliER8DrWt5BjJ14kOU= +go.dtapp.net/golog v1.0.51/go.mod h1:aXer1I0jFUFfcNKeftAf0S6yKT86dhQ8manUWXIJ2ZE= go.dtapp.net/gorandom v1.0.1 h1:IWfMClh1ECPvyUjlqD7MwLq4mZdUusD1qAwAdsvEJBs= go.dtapp.net/gorandom v1.0.1/go.mod h1:ZPdgalKpvFV/ATQqR0k4ns/F/IpITAZpx6WkWirr5Y8= -go.dtapp.net/gorequest v1.0.27 h1:Hip1mfSZJDNcmE2iZgB3PYa0C/7BAMEJLsCaMd6t9iE= -go.dtapp.net/gorequest v1.0.27/go.mod h1:922s7pjYulKIytUMGAYS4aHU6cnzTbOQURGBPCKSxAk= +go.dtapp.net/gorequest v1.0.28 h1:EehFtF5WcvyZ9rB6MAQoI2kJkhR8Wv8tVgpoxXcb3sI= +go.dtapp.net/gorequest v1.0.28/go.mod h1:Nr0BIOXhapY3Es86hL7pN2c2PgjZwImcrWdMpLzHlJE= go.dtapp.net/gostring v1.0.10 h1:eG+1kQehdJUitj9Hfwy79SndMHYOB7ABpWkTs7mDGeQ= go.dtapp.net/gostring v1.0.10/go.mod h1:L4kREy89a9AraMHB5tUjjl+5rxP1gpXkDouRKKuzT50= go.dtapp.net/gotime v1.0.5 h1:12aNgB2ULpP6QgQHEUkLilZ4ASvhpFxMFQkBwn0par8= diff --git a/wxa.get_qrcode.go b/wxa.get_qrcode.go index 5835366..6fd5dba 100644 --- a/wxa.get_qrcode.go +++ b/wxa.get_qrcode.go @@ -48,7 +48,7 @@ func (c *Client) WxaGetQrcode(ctx context.Context, path string) (*WxaGetQrcodeRe // 定义 var response WxaGetQrcodeResponse // 判断内容是否为图片 - if request.ResponseHeader.Get("Content-Type") == "image/jpeg" || request.ResponseHeader.Get("Content-Type") == "image/png" || request.ResponseHeader.Get("Content-Type") == "image/jpg" { + if request.HeaderIsImg() { } else { err = json.Unmarshal(request.ResponseBody, &response) if err != nil {